This alert fires when the Pinewhistle deduplicator's suppression queue exceeds its safe depth, meaning duplicate pages may begin reaching on-call engineers. As release manager, confirm whether a recent rollout changed fingerprinting rules before acknowledging. Sustained depth above threshold for ten minutes warrants a rollback review. Triage guidance is maintained on the internal page below.

operations page: https://jenkins.zemvarcloud.local/job/merge_requests/repo/build/73930b4b30f0a8ed

**Action item (from the Glowbar outage review):** The admin dashboard's dark mode still hardcodes a handful of hex colors, which is why the incident banner was invisible to half the on-call crew last Tuesday. Someone needs to sweep the remaining components and move everything onto the Duskline token set before the next release. It's tedious but mechanical. The checklist of offending components and the token mapping table are on the internal page below.

runbook for kajef-bahof: https://jenkins.tolvaqsoft.corp/view/ticket/secrets/run/a519a107883db9da

Heads up, support folks: the AddressPing autocomplete widget keeps failing CI on the Fernwick runners because the mock geocoder times out before suggestions render. It's flaky, not broken — reruns usually pass. If a customer reports missing suggestions, check whether their build predates the timeout bump. The relevant trace token is right below this note.

pipeline stamp: htk9_ce63042d9

[ ] Key ceremony step 7 — Pagination keys, Quillport public REST API. Confirm cursor-signing key pair generated on the air-gapped Herrin terminal. Verify opaque cursors are HMAC-signed so clients cannot forge page offsets against the Quillport catalog endpoints. Check max page size enforced server-side (100). Confirm old cursor key scheduled for 30-day overlap, then destruction. Record both custodians present. Escrow copy sealed in the Marlowe safe. The escrow envelope must contain the recovery passphrase, which follows below.

unlock words, kajef-kadug: sorys-pelax-lamael-tamvan-briiel-novdor-fenwyn-tamdor-oliion-keleth-julok-belion-ralok